350 Stopni - Pizza Romana & Prosecco Bar, Takeaway pizzeria and Italian restaurant in Centrum, Białystok, Poland
350 Stopni - Pizza Romana & Prosecco Bar is a takeaway pizzeria and Italian restaurant located in the Centrum district of Białystok, Poland. The kitchen is partly visible from the entrance, seating inside is compact, and outdoor spots are available in good weather.
The restaurant opened as part of a broader wave of Italian-inspired dining that took hold in Polish cities over recent decades. Its focus on Roman-style pizza reflects a wider trend of bringing specific regional Italian cooking traditions to Poland.
The name '350 Stopni' refers to the high temperature at which the pizza is baked, giving a direct nod to the cooking method. The bar area is a small but lively spot where guests often linger over a glass of prosecco before or after their meal.
The restaurant sits in the center of Białystok and is easy to reach on foot if you are already in the main area of the city. It tends to get busy around lunchtime and in the evening, so arriving a little early can help avoid a wait.
The pizza here is made in the Roman style, with a very thin and crispy base, which sets it apart from the Neapolitan version with its softer, puffed edge. This style is still less common in Poland than the Neapolitan one, making it a point of interest for those curious about regional differences.
